Every year Valparaiso Garden Club of Valparaiso, Florida, stages a Standard Flower Show. This type of show differs from others in that it meets all requirements as listed in the Flower Show Handbook, a publication of National Garden Clubs.

Taking care of monkey flowers is easy as long as they get plenty of moisture. They thrive in full sun or partial shade.In addition, the monkey flower plant is an important larval host for Baltimore and Common Buckeye butterflies.
